About Bruises

Artist and Song: Lewis Capaldi - Bruises
Album: Divinely Uninspired to a Hellish Extent
Genre: Alternative, Indie
Year: 2019
Difficulty: Hard
Tuning: G C E A
Key: C#m
Chords: [C#m], [A], [E], [B], [G#m], [F#m]
Strumming: D - DU - DU - DU
